Title:
  clicking on top panel should raise maximized windows

Bug description:
  [Test Case]
  1. Start a maximized application
  2. Start a unmaximized (restored) application
  3. Focus the unmaximized (restored) application
  4. Left-click the panel titlebar
     -> The maximized application should get focused and moved to the top

  [Regression Potential]
  Potentially clicking the panel with the mouse button can stop working or work 
incorrectly.

  Original description:

  This bug is very similar to bug #703411 and should be able to be fixed
  in much the same way.  This issue comes up when raise-on-click is
  deactivated, in which case it is impossible to raise a maximized
  window that is not already on top.  Clicking on the top panel should
  raise the window, just like middle-clicking lowers it.  The fix should
  be reasonably simple; please let me know if I should provide a patch.
